引言
在当今数字化时代,网络速度和稳定性对于我们的工作和生活至关重要。尤其是在访问被限制的网站或进行科学上网时,提升网络性能成为了一个重要的议题。本文将深入探讨Windows TCP Fast Open与Shadowsocks的结合使用,如何通过优化设置来实现更高效的网络访问。
什么是TCP Fast Open?
TCP Fast Open是一个TCP扩展,可以减少网络延迟,提高数据传输效率。其工作原理是在建立TCP连接时,客户端可以在握手过程中提前发送数据,从而加速数据的传输过程。
TCP Fast Open的优势
- 减少延迟:通过提前发送数据,减少了TCP连接的建立时间。
- 提升用户体验:在加载网页和视频时,用户能感受到明显的速度提升。
- 适用于多种场景:尤其是在访问内容丰富的网站时,效果更加显著。
什么是Shadowsocks?
Shadowsocks是一款开源的代理工具,旨在通过SOCKS5协议实现科学上网。它通过加密的方式帮助用户突破网络封锁,提高网络的隐私性和安全性。
Shadowsocks的主要功能
- 加密数据传输:保护用户隐私,防止数据被监控。
- 支持多种平台:Windows、macOS、Linux及移动设备均可使用。
- 配置灵活:用户可以根据自身需求,调整服务器和端口设置。
如何在Windows上设置TCP Fast Open和Shadowsocks
要在Windows上实现TCP Fast Open和Shadowsocks的结合使用,需要遵循以下步骤:
1. 确保Windows支持TCP Fast Open
-
打开命令提示符,输入以下命令以检查是否启用TCP Fast Open: cmd netsh interface tcp show global
-
如果TCP Fast Open未启用,请执行: cmd netsh interface tcp set global fastopen=enabled
2. 下载并安装Shadowsocks客户端
- 从Shadowsocks的官方网站下载Windows客户端。
- 安装并运行Shadowsocks客户端。
3. 配置Shadowsocks服务器
- 在Shadowsocks客户端中输入服务器的地址、端口和密码。
- 选择加密方式,如AES-256-GCM。
4. 启用TCP Fast Open选项
- 在Shadowsocks的设置中,寻找有关TCP Fast Open的选项,并启用它。
- 确保在使用时客户端处于正常连接状态。
5. 测试网络连接
- 使用浏览器访问被限制的网站,观察加载速度。
- 可以使用网络测速工具,测试速度和延迟。
Windows TCP Fast Open与Shadowsocks的优化建议
- 选择合适的服务器:选择延迟低、带宽大的服务器,有助于提高速度。
- 定期更新软件:确保Shadowsocks和Windows系统都是最新版本,以获得最佳性能。
- 使用DNS加密:防止DNS污染,提升安全性。
常见问题解答
TCP Fast Open在Shadowsocks中的作用是什么?
TCP Fast Open可以在TCP连接建立时,提前发送数据包,从而减少延迟,提升在使用Shadowsocks时的访问速度。
如何验证TCP Fast Open是否工作?
可以使用网络分析工具,如Wireshark,观察TCP连接建立的时间和数据传输情况,确认是否有效。
TCP Fast Open对所有网络都有效吗?
TCP Fast Open在不同网络条件下表现不同。在某些网络环境中,可能效果不明显,尤其是在延迟较高的情况下。
我可以在移动设备上使用TCP Fast Open吗?
目前,TCP Fast Open主要在桌面操作系统中得到广泛支持,移动设备的实现情况取决于具体操作系统的支持。
结论
结合Windows TCP Fast Open与Shadowsocks可以显著提高网络的使用体验,尤其是在访问被封锁的内容时。通过适当的设置和优化,用户可以享受更快速、更安全的网络服务。希望本教程能够帮助您更好地利用这些工具,实现流畅的网络访问。